Bush lauds construction of presidential library

DALLAS (AP).- Former President George W. Bush said Monday that his presidential center will be a venue for learning and action, and that it already exceeds his expectations. The George W. Bush Presidential Center will feature a presidential library and policy institute when it opens in spring 2013. Bush said the institute, which will focus on education reform, global health, human freedom and economic growth, will help him to stay involved in the areas that interest him. “The challenge is after you are president to make sure you are still constructive, that you add something to society,” Bush told some 600 people gathered at a ceremony to mark the placement of center’s last construction beam. “I thought long and hard about how I wanted to do that.” He described the center as “an exciting place.
